Output 3c89650edfb3c1e9e60dead2f181771a57c83fdc04df6847b26720b58a44dc70:13

value
1464194
script pubkey
OP_0 OP_PUSHBYTES_32 38f515be4db19450a6dd9f14ed4ea3f1eb94fdbd2911ce0d915cda9c6b11e807
address
bc1q8r63t0jdkx29pfkanu2w6n4r784eflda9yguurv3tndfc6c3aqrsgdv29z
transaction
3c89650edfb3c1e9e60dead2f181771a57c83fdc04df6847b26720b58a44dc70